Now, a debate has taken over TikTok. The central question of this debate? The best way to draw stars. Is there really an unacceptable way to do it?
What’s ‘Psycho’ About How This Man Draws A Star?
In a viral video with over 848,000 views, TikTok user Kayla (@drkayla_md) reveals an argument she’s been having with her husband.
“Please settle a debate that my husband and I are having on how to draw a star,” she starts.
She then shows her husband in front of a dry-erase board.
“Ross, show ’em how you draw your stars,” Kayla says. Ross proceeds to draw a star. To do so, he starts at the top, then draws a straight line to the bottom left. From there, he draws another straight line up to the right, then across to the left, back down to the right, and finally, connecting everything with another line to the top.
“OK, that is psycho,” Kayla says. “That is psycho behavior.”
Kayla then announces that she’s going to “show you how I do it”—which she claims is “the right way to do it.” To draw the star, she simply starts at the bottom left, carries up to the top, goes down to the bottom right, then makes her way over to the top left before crossing to the right and, eventually, making a straight line down to connect the star.
“Please tell him that he is doing it incorrectly and that my way is definitely the right way,” Kayla declares.
What’s The Correct Way To Draw A Star?
There is no “right” way to draw a five-point star. In fact, several guides for doing so offer different explanations on how to do it.
For example, some tutorials on YouTube show a method similar to the one employed by Kayla. Others show disconnected lines that begin at the top, while further tutorials offer an explanation comparable to the one shown by Kayla’s partner.
There are even some guides that start with a horizontal line, and additional ones that begin with drawing the letter “A.”
So long as one successfully draws a star, there’s really nothing “psycho” about the method they use to do it.
Plus, as the pentagram has been in active use for around 5,000 years, there’s a strong chance that every single possible method of drawing it has been used at one point or another.
